#434b80 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#434b80 is composed of 26.3% red, 29.4% green and 50.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 47.7% cyan, 41.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 49.8% black. It has a hue angle of 232.1 degrees, a saturation of 31.3% and a lightness of 38.2%. #434b80 color hex could be obtained by blending #8696ff with #000001. Closest websafe color is: #333399.

● #434b80 color description : Dark moderate blue.
The hexadecimal color #434b80 has RGB values of R:67, G:75, B:128 and CMYK values of C:0.48, M:0.41, Y:0, K:0.5. Its decimal value is 4410240.
